## How to peer review and sign guide
|
||
|
||
> Heads-up: in order to establish a web of trust, peer reviewers are expected to have public track records.
|
||
|
||
### Step 1: clone [repo](https://github.com/sunknudsen/privacy-guides)
|
||
|
||
### Step 2: checkout [draft](https://github.com/sunknudsen/privacy-guides/tree/draft)
|
||
|
||
### Step 3: review guide and submit suggestions using [issues](https://github.com/sunknudsen/privacy-guides/issues)
|
||
|
||
Once consensus has been reached (issues are closed) and updated guide has been published to [draft.sunknudsen.com](https://draft.sunknudsen.com/), time for [step 4](#step-4-append-yourself-to-reviewers-comma-separated).
|
||
|
||
### Step 4: append yourself to `Reviewers` (comma-separated)
|
||
|
||
Example:
|
||
|
||
```markdown
|
||
<!--
|
||
Title: How to append yourself to reviewers
|
||
Description: Learn how to append yourself to reviewers.
|
||
Author: Sun Knudsen <https://github.com/sunknudsen>
|
||
Contributors: Sun Knudsen <https://github.com/sunknudsen>
|
||
Reviewers: Alice <https://github.com/alice>, Bob <https://github.com/bob>
|
||
Publication date: 2021-01-24T13:11:17.464Z
|
||
Listed: true
|
||
-->
|
||
```
|
||
|
||
### Step 5: submit [signed](#how-to-sign-pull-requests) pull request
|
||
|
||
👍

## How to sign pull requests
|
||
|
||
### Step 1: add PGP public key to GitHub account
|
||
|
||
Go to https://github.com/settings/keys, click “New GPG key”, paste your PGP public key and click “Add GPG key”.
|
||
|
||
### Step 2: enable Git [signing](https://git-scm.com/book/en/v2/Git-Tools-Signing-Your-Work)
|
||
|
||
Replace `0x8C9CA674C47CA060` with your PGP public key ID.
|
||
|
||
```shell
|
||
git config --global commit.gpgsign true
|
||
git config --global gpg.program $(which gpg)
|
||
git config --global user.signingkey 0x8C9CA674C47CA060
|
||
```
|
||
|
||
### Step 3: submit pull request
|
||
|
||
👍
